6.3
Reference run
After switching on, a reference run must be car-
ried out to determine the mechanical zero points.
Operation button [A] flashes.
To start the reference run:
▷ Briefly push operation button [A].
The reference run is started. Operation button
[A] lights up.
The reference run can be stopped:
▷ Briefly push operation button [A].
The reference run is stopped. Operation button
[A] flashes.
To continue the reference run:
▷ Briefly push operation button [A].
The reference run is continued at the position
where it was stopped. Operation button [A]
lights up.
On completion of the reference run, the machine
returns to the starting position. Operation button
[A] goes out.
6.4

Program execution

Before executing a program, it must first be
loaded (see Ceramill Match 2 Software).
▷ Briefly push operation button [A].
The program is started. Operation button [A]
lights up.
The program can be stopped:
▷ Briefly press operation button [A] or service
button [B].
-or-
▷ Open the door.
The program is stopped. Operation button [A]
flashes.
